# zarinpal-checkout
A modern, type-safe ZarinPal checkout client for Node.js. This `1.0.0` release keeps backward-compatible method names while upgrading internals, tooling, and tests.

## Features
- ✅ TypeScript-first with bundled type definitions
- ✅ Backward-compatible APIs (`create`, `PaymentRequest`, `PaymentVerification`, `UnverifiedTransactions`, `RefreshAuthority`, `TokenBeautifier`)
- ✅ Options-based client creation with `createWithOptions`
- ✅ Sandbox and production mode support
- ✅ Currency support for `IRR` and `IRT`
- ✅ Configurable request timeout handling
- ✅ Fast built-in Node.js test runner
- ✅ Strict linting + type-checking workflows
- ✅ Rollup build output (ESM + CJS) with declaration bundling
- ✅ Ready-to-run examples for all public methods

### Backward-compatible API (recommended for existing users)
```ts
import ZarinpalCheckout from 'zarinpal-checkout';
const zarinpal = ZarinpalCheckout.create(
'xxxxxx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x',
false,
'IRT'
);
const request = await zarinpal.PaymentRequest({
Amount: 1000,
CallbackURL: 'https://example.com/payment/callback',
Description: 'Order #123',
Email: 'user@example.com',
Mobile: '09120000000'
});
console.log(request.url);
```
### Options-based API
```ts
import { createWithOptions } from 'zarinpal-checkout';
const zarinpal = createWithOptions('xxxxxx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x', {
sandbox: true,
currency: 'IRR',
timeoutMs: 8000
});
```

## API Reference
### `PaymentRequest(input)`
Creates a payment authority.
### `PaymentVerification(input)`
Verifies a completed payment authority.
### `UnverifiedTransactions()`
Fetches unverified authorities.
### `RefreshAuthority(input)`
Refreshes an existing authority expiration.
### `TokenBeautifier(token)`
Preserves previous token beautifier behavior.
